2 parts in 1 fascicle. Revue d'Art Oriental et d'Archéologie. Publié par l'IFAPO, Tome XXIV. Paul Geuthner, Paul, 1944-1945. In-4, 147 pages. Original softcover, in excellent condition, except for a small tear on the spine. Contents: VIROLLEAUD Fragments mythologiques de Ras Shamra - DUPONT SOMMER L'ostracon araméen d'Assour - Antiquités syriennes. Héraclès-Nergal, par H. Seyrig - Two Tomb-Groups of the first century A. D. from Yahmour, Syria, and a supplement to the list of Roman-Syrian glasses with mould-blown inscriptions, by D. B. HARDEN - SAUVAGET Notes de topographie omeyyade. Bibliographie. Language: French.
